A practical cadence based on function, danger, and regulation

No single routine fits every person. The appropriate period depends upon exposure to situations, just how your organisation documents and monitors responses, and whether you hold a time-limited credential. Start with duty risk.

High-contact functions require even more regular refresher courses. This includes mental health and wellness support officers, peer advocates, HR organization companions for huge teams, school wellness staff, front-line leaders in hospitality and retail, and any person called in crucial case plans. Moderate-contact roles, like general supervisors, instructors without pastoral treatment responsibilities, or safety and security associates in low-risk atmospheres, can extend the period a little if they exercise in between training courses. Low-contact roles, or those with indirect duties, can embrace a wider window supplied they join drills and brief skill checks.

Suggested periods you can protect in audits and practice

If you need a baseline to compose into policy or individual advancement strategies, these intervals have actually verified workable throughout sectors.

For those with assigned duties for crisis mental health response, routine a mental health refresher every one year. This can be a compressed program, an evaluated situation workshop, or a details 11379NAT mental health refresher course if your service provider offers one straightened to the initial proficiencies. Twelve months lines up with how promptly reference networks, emergency pathways, and organisational plans transform, and it aesthetics skill fade long prior to it becomes medically significant.

For group leaders and HR generalists who field worries but rarely manage acute crises, 12 to 18 months functions, given they take part in quarterly micro-drills or instance reviews. If your organisation can not run internal practice, remain closer to 12 months.

For line personnel that complete an emergency treatment for mental health course as component of wide wellbeing campaigns, 18 to 24 months is affordable if the environment has reduced exposure to crises and the group does scenario-based toolbox talks a minimum of two times a year.

For regulated atmospheres such as education and learning, community services, and healthcare, straighten with organisational plan. Numerous healthcare facilities and area service providers established year for crisis mental health training and 24 months for basic mental health courses. If you hold a mental health certificate or various other certifications for mental health embedded in task descriptions, your competency framework may call for proof of money every year.

Why skills discolor in this domain name faster than in physical initial aid

I have actually seen people keep CPR sequences in their go to two years, yet lose the core of de-escalation language for mental health and wellness in 6 months. The difference is sound. Discussions throughout crisis are vibrant and emotionally loaded. People recall feeling greater than specific words, so the crisp sentences that protect against acceleration slip away unless rehearsed. There is also variability. No 2 situations look alike. Without routine exposure to limited, realistic scenarios, -responders begin to improvise, which increases risk.

Moreover, neighborhood sources transform. In many Australian areas, after-hours crisis teams, head to wellness centers, and emergency situation division triage pathways change in months, not years. A 1 year void can leave you directing a person to a shut door.

Signs a refresher is overdue also if the schedule states otherwise

Calendar periods are blunt. Look for cues in practice.

When coworkers avoid the initial 2 mins of a challenging discussion and try to outsource quickly, they have shed self-confidence in the preliminary feedback. When you hear out-of-date language that could raise embarassment, such as framing self-harm as focus looking for, it is time to freshen. If incident reports show confusion concerning privacy, consent, and responsibility of care, a focused upgrade is immediate. And if you have not run a drill in 6 months, the team is not all set, even if every person holds a recent certificate.

Building a maintenance plan that really fits genuine work

A sustainable strategy secures time and maintains technique active between official sessions. Obtain from safety-critical areas. Pilots do quick, constant drills, shortly occasions once a year. Apply the very same version to first aid in mental health.

Here is a portable upkeep design numerous teams can run without overwhelming calendars:

    Quarterly 20-minute micro-scenarios. One person plays the customer or associate in distress, an additional plays the -responder. Turn. Use scripts attracted from your occurrence motifs: anxiety attack, extreme distress after performance responses, a worker revealing self-destructive ideation, or a client in agitation. Six-monthly plan refresh. A short huddle to validate what is a mental health crisis in your context, who to call first, and exactly how to document. Annual official refresher course. Select a certified mental health refresher course, such as a provider-aligned mental health refresher course 11379NAT if you need positioning to expertise, or a premium first aid mental health training session that consists of assessment, not just discussion.

This framework keeps language fresh, tightens up role quality, and captures policy drift early. It additionally normalises practice, which lowers stigma around requesting aid mid-incident.

What to try to find in a refresher course so it really moves practice

Not all programs are equivalent. In analyses I have actually conducted, the programs that stick share attributes. They make use of reasonable, unpleasant circumstances, not scripted perfection. They rehearse the specific words that pacify stress, after that allow individuals discover their very own voice. They consist of a brief, racked up evaluation of danger triage and decision factors, since being observed adjustments just how seriously we prepare. They instruct what to do when a strategy fails. And they make the neighborhood path specific: who answers after hours, what to do if voicemail gets, which manager holds the task phone.

If you are acquiring courses in mental health for a team, inquire about the ratio of circumstance time to talk time. Anything under 40 percent situation time is unlikely to shift habits. For recognized programs, verify the trainer's history consists of online crisis mental health work, not just classroom delivery.

Special contexts that necessitate tighter intervals

Certain atmospheres demand shorter cycles. In severe medical care, emergency services, dilemma helplines, domestic treatment, and youth solutions, exposure to energetic situations is regular. In these settings, six to twelve months for a formal refresher is typical, with regular monthly or bimonthly situation method embedded into guidance. For colleges during periods of enhanced distress across the pupil body, strategy additional sessions mid-year. For organisations going through restructures, redundancies, or public conflicts, run a targeted refresher concentrated on suicide threat, pain responses, and staff-to-staff support despite the normal schedule.

A short, defensible plan you can adapt

If you require to order this, right here is an easy theme you can tailor:

    Foundation: all designated responders finish an accredited training program such as the 11379NAT course in initial response to a mental health crisis or an equivalent first aid mental health course. Currency: designated responders complete a mental health refresher every 12 months; managers and HR generalists every 12 to 18 months; other staff every 18 to 24 months based upon threat assessment. Maintenance: quarterly micro-scenarios and a six-monthly policy update for all teams; post-incident learning testimonials within 2 weeks of a crisis. Governance: maintain a real-time register of training and money; align training course choice with nationally accredited training where required; testimonial this policy annually.

Keep it light-weight and maintain it lived. A policy that drives technique is worth ten that sit unread.
